Christine Kress, DNP, APRN, WHNP-BC, NEA-BC, MSCP

Air Force Col. (ret.) Christine Hart Kress, DNP, APRN, WHNP-BC, NEA-BC, MSCP is a seasoned healthcare leader with over 30 years of experience in women’s health. She is the CEO and owner of a specialized telemedicine practice focused on comprehensive menopause and midlife care. Retired Colonel Hart Kress proudly served 27 years in the United States Air Force as a Women’s Health Nurse Practitioner and Healthcare Executive. After retirement, she transitioned to a Chief Nursing Officer role in a hospital system then returned to clinical practice in gynecology.
Board-certified as a Menopause Society Certified Practitioner, Dr. Hart Kress has advanced training in hormone prescribing, sexual medicine and the care of breast cancer survivors. Her passion lies in transforming access to high-quality care for women in midlife and menopause. She is an active member of the National Association of Nurse Practitioners in Women’s Health Advocacy Committee and has co-authored several key resources, including the Scope of Practice and Health and Healthcare of Midlife Women position statements.
A published author in the field of women’s health, Dr. Hart Kress has a large social media following and has been featured on multiple podcasts and blogs, sharing her expertise and insights. She is the co-host of the new podcast, “The Dusty Muffins.” She has received numerous accolades for her clinical excellence and leadership, including the Air Force Medical Service Advanced Practice Nurse of the Year and Tucson’s Fabulous 50 Nurses awards.
